Planning This Winter’s Ski Trip Beforehand Would Help

Planning your ski vacations well in advance would help you get better deals at ski resorts. It goes without saying that costs would be higher than usual once the peak season gets underway. So, to avoid spending excessively on hotel bookings and ski trips, it is advisable that you begin planning your ski vacation beforehand.
The Major Risk Involved
Well, there’s a major risk associated with advance bookings. The problem is you do not know how the conditions would pan out in the region. Planning for ski trips in advance won’t be an issue for experienced campaigners, as there's every possibility that they'd already know the right time to do all the bookings.
It Is Important to Decide the Destination Beforehand
The harsh reality about scheduling your ski vacation is that it is quite uncertain. No one can tell you if the place chosen by you would have sufficient snow cover for you to enjoy skiing. Even if you don’t find enough snow cover, the base of the terrain needs to be good. This way, you’d have a good enough terrain for undertaking skiing. Statistical patterns of snowfall in the past can also be referred to before heading to the slopes.

Having an Insurance Would Help
Booking for your skiing trip well in advance is definitely a good exercise. It is always a good idea to get your trips insured. Try searching for an insurance that can be reimbursed in case you plan to postpone the trip at the last moment. A host of factors can be responsible for the delay such as crowds, personal commitments, weather conditions, road closures, etc.
